Transaction 2139a10be088031245295d4b826e3b3f7ff42ea311372b244364826a369a73de

1 Input
2 Outputs
  • 2139a10be088031245295d4b826e3b3f7ff42ea311372b244364826a369a73de:0
  • value  24346091
    address  3BJLiQ6hDSyXDv946ko7256ViRk3SVZQLh
  • 2139a10be088031245295d4b826e3b3f7ff42ea311372b244364826a369a73de:1
  • value  523066
    address  1Pq99vL3G42uVokfFDn7D73nGdE5RRMLf6